Technical Underpinnings of Quantum Encryption

At the heart of Quantum Protection Wallets lies quantum encryption, a technology that leverages the principles of quantum mechanics to create virtually unbreakable encryption. To understand how this works, it’s essential to grasp some fundamental concepts of quantum mechanics.

Qubits and Superposition

In classical computing, data is processed using bits, which can be either 0 or 1. Quantum computing, however, uses qubits, which can exist in multiple states simultaneously due to the principle of superposition. This allows quantum computers to process a vast amount of information at once, far surpassing the capabilities of classical computers.

Quantum encryption utilizes these qubits to create encryption keys that are exponentially more complex than those used in classical encryption. This complexity ensures that any attempt to decrypt the data using conventional methods would take an impractically long time, even for the most powerful quantum computers.

Entanglement and Quantum Key Distribution (QKD)

Another key principle of quantum mechanics is entanglement, where qubits become interconnected in such a way that the state of one qubit is directly related to the state of another, regardless of the distance between them. This property is harnessed in Quantum Key Distribution (QKD), a method used in Quantum Protection Wallets to securely share encryption keys.

QKD ensures that any eavesdropping attempt on the communication channel would disturb the entangled qubits, thereby alerting the communicating parties to the presence of an intruder. This feature provides a high level of security and is one of the primary reasons why quantum encryption is considered quantum-resistant.

One of the most significant implications of digital finance is its role in democratizing investment. Traditionally, investing in stocks, bonds, or real estate often required significant capital and access to professional advisors. However, the proliferation of user-friendly investment apps has dramatically lowered these barriers. With just a few dollars, individuals can now start building a diversified portfolio, benefiting from the power of compounding returns. These platforms offer educational resources, market insights, and even automated investment strategies, making sophisticated wealth-building accessible to everyone, regardless of their prior financial knowledge. This accessibility is a game-changer, allowing more people to participate in wealth creation and build a more secure financial future.

The rise of alternative assets, facilitated by digital finance, also presents exciting opportunities. Non-fungible tokens (NFTs), for instance, have emerged as a new way to own and trade digital assets, from art and collectibles to virtual real estate. While still a nascent and somewhat volatile market, NFTs represent a novel form of digital ownership and a potential avenue for income generation through creation, trading, or even renting out digital assets. Similarly, the burgeoning market for decentralized finance (DeFi) applications, built on blockchain technology, offers innovative ways to lend, borrow, and earn interest on digital assets, often with higher yields than traditional financial institutions. These innovations are pushing the boundaries of what constitutes an "asset" and how value can be created and exchanged.

The concept of passive income is also being radically reshaped by digital finance. Traditionally, passive income might have involved rental properties or dividend-paying stocks. Today, digital finance offers a multitude of new avenues. Staking cryptocurrencies, for example, allows holders to earn rewards by locking up their digital assets to support a blockchain network. Yield farming in DeFi protocols can generate significant returns by providing liquidity to decentralized exchanges. Even creating and selling digital products, such as online courses, e-books, or software, can generate recurring revenue streams with relatively little ongoing effort once the initial creation is complete. These digital income streams offer the potential for financial freedom, allowing individuals to earn money while they sleep, travel, or pursue other passions.

However, navigating this digital financial landscape requires a keen understanding of the associated risks. Cybersecurity is paramount. As more of our financial lives move online, protecting our digital assets from theft and fraud becomes increasingly critical. This means employing strong passwords, enabling two-factor authentication, and being vigilant against phishing scams. Understanding the volatility of certain digital assets, such as cryptocurrencies, is also essential. While the potential for high returns exists, so does the risk of significant losses. Responsible investing and a well-diversified approach are crucial to mitigating these risks.

The evolving nature of work, spurred by digital finance and the gig economy, also brings with it considerations for benefits and long-term security. Traditional employment often comes with employer-sponsored health insurance, retirement plans, and paid time off. Individuals earning digital income, particularly through freelance or contract work, need to proactively plan for these aspects of their financial well-being. This might involve purchasing private health insurance, setting up individual retirement accounts (IRAs), and diligently saving for periods of lower income. It’s about building a robust and resilient financial safety net in a less traditional employment structure.

The impact of digital finance on financial inclusion is also a crucial aspect to consider. In many parts of the world, access to traditional banking services is limited. Digital finance, through mobile money platforms and accessible online services, is bridging this gap, bringing financial services to underserved populations and empowering them to participate more fully in the global economy. This has the potential to lift communities out of poverty and foster economic development on a scale never before possible.
